Origins

Blooming teas have their origins where else than in China. Once upon a time, watching them unfold was one of the favorite pastimes of members of the imperial court. In the 1960s, however, the Chinese government intervened in this tradition and banned their production as a bourgeois and aristocratic relic. It is only in the last few decades that blooming tea has made a comeback. Fortunately, they are now also making their way to Europe, so that we can present them to all our loved ones.

Making blooming tea is not easy. It is mostly done by women and girls who have skilled and careful hands. It is necessary to neatly but firmly tie several green or white tea leaves and place a colorful and fragrant flower such as tea tree bloom, jasmine, hibiscus, peony or marigold at the center.

In a 100g package of blooming tea you will usually find 15 balls of blooming tea, but the actual number solely depends on its weight. Each can be steeped several times. If the tea flower does not cease to amaze you even after the last infusion, you can display it in clean and cold water for a few days as a decoration.

Preparation

Temperature 80 °C Preparation time 3-5 minutes

Instructions for preparation

Pour 300ml of boiled water (80°C) per 1 ball of flowering tea.
Let steep for 3-5 minutes.
Once the tea has bloomed, it can be brewed again for 1-2 times.
